Yes, as stated by platoonist the S means Static. Guess I'll have to use imgur or something for pictures, but I'll just post the pop-up text here for now. Both units below are part of IV US Bomber Cmnd (West Coast). In the list of air units attached to IV US Bomber Cmnd they are written as; 39th BG/12th RS [S]# and 41st BG/48th BS When hovering over both names this is the text in the pop-ups; 39th BG/12th RS [S] (D) withdraws in 59 day(s) Returns later as a new group and 41st BG/48th BS Can upgrade to A-29 Hudson from Dec,1941 Can resize to 16 from Aug,1942 Both units are detachments of a full unit, so I don't think the D has anything to do with that. I have only seen this D behind the name of units set to withdraw. I also see that 41st BG/HqS# and 42nd BG/HqS# (both set to withdraw as you can see) don't have this D in their pop-up, but instead have a W. The three other HqS-units under IV US Bomber Cmnd have the D. Only difference I can see is that the two HqS with W instead of D have units in the detachment that are not set to withdraw, while the HqS-units with D have all parts of the group set to withdraw. If anybody want to see this instead of reading my bad descriptions, just load up any main scenario and check the units under IV US Bomber Cmnd. And yes, it's a D, not a P. :)
